<B>Fr. 207 $50 1861 Interest Bearing Note CGA Very Fine 25.</B></I> This 1861 $50 Interest Bearing Note is unique to our best knowledge. It is the only piece recorded in the Gengerke census and it had previously been part of the Harry Bass Research Foundation. Its only prior market appearance was in 1999 when Bowers and Merena sold the Bass Foundation notes. At that sale, it realized $86,250. This piece is missing from all museum collections, including the Smithsonian. It's a gorgeous VF with fresh original ink colors, and no problems worthy of mention. It's beautifully margined and has two of its original five coupons remaining. Issued contemporarily with Demand Notes, this bill used the same format where various Treasury employees signed "for the" register and treasurer. On this note, both signatures remain beautifully sharp. The note was originally made payable to a Colonel Samuel Colt and is endorsed on the back by him, which turned it into a bearer instrument.
